20130291985 | Fluid Energy Reducing Device - A fluid energy reducing device includes a body having multiple, oppositely directed flow restrictors extending away from opposite sides of the body. Each flow restrictor can have a geometric shape such as a pyramid, triangle, or a conical shape. Fluid such as a fuel traveling in a wave entering the flow restrictors accelerates as the flow area in a flow passage of the flow restrictors decreases. The work performed by accelerating the fluid flow through one or more apertures created in each flow restrictor reduces the energy of the wave, thereby reducing noise in the fluid tank having the fluid energy reducing device when the reduced size and velocity wave subsequently strikes tank structure or walls. | 11-07-2013 |

20100288389 | Choke Assembly - A choke assembly. In some embodiments, the choke assembly includes a choke element having a fluid flow passage therethrough. The choke element includes a cage having a plurality of apertures therethrough for the passage of fluid and a plug moveable with respect to the cage. The plug has an end surface that defines a boundary of the fluid flow passage through the choke and is moveable to open or close each of the apertures through the cage, whereby the flow of fluid through the cage is controlled. The apertures in the cage are disposed in a first portion and a second portion separated by a land. Each of the first and second portions has a least one aperture therein. The plug may be positioned with its end surface disposed to intersect the land, such that each aperture is fully open or fully closed to the flow of fluid. | 11-18-2010 |

20130255815 | FLUID CONDUIT WITH VARIABLE FLOW RESISTANCE - A fluid-carrying conduit achieves variable resistance to flow. An elongate, hollow body casing has at least one chamber containing either a dilatant fluid or an electroactive polymer. In the case of the dilatant fluid, a reduction in an effective flow cross section of the fluid line occurs in reaction to an increase in the shear rate of a fluid flowing through the fluid line. In the case of the electroactive polymer, a reduction in an effective flow cross section of the fluid line occurs in reaction to an electric current being applied to the body casing. The conduit may be configured for use as a degassing line in a cooling system of an internal combustion engine. The conduit may have a reinforcement encircling the electroactive polymer. The conduit may have an electrically conductive connecting surface adjacent to the electroactive polymer. The electroactive polymer may be an ionic electroactive polymer. | 10-03-2013 |
